Biography

A/Prof Daniel Lemberg is a Conjoint Associate Professor in the School of Clinical Medicine at UNSW Australia. He has an extensive clinical research background specializing in pediatric gastroenterology, particularly in inflammatory bowel diseases (IBD). Lemberg has been pivotal in advancing our understanding of the pathogenetic mechanisms underlying diseases such as Crohn's disease and has made significant contributions to the management of children and adolescents with IBD. His clinical expertise includes the use of exclusive enteral nutrition and probiotics. Since being appointed Head of Pediatric Gastroenterology at Sydney Children’s Hospital in 2010, he has directed the Children’s Inflammatory Bowel Diseases Clinic and is recognized for his innovative research utilizing next-generation sequencing technology to explore intestinal microbiota alterations in IBD. Furthermore, his research interests extend to coeliac disease and eosinophilic oesophagitis, focusing on clinical trends and treatment efficacy in these conditions. Lemberg has been honored with several awards, including the GESA Young Investigator Award, and actively engages in professional communities as an Associate Editor for Frontiers in Pediatric Gastroenterology and Hepatology, while also contributing to the Gastroenterology Society of Australasia.
